摘要

为改善Kinect采集到的用户运动时骨骼节点位置的跳变随机性以及平滑用户动作过程中各骨骼关节的角度,对运动数据的采集和计算算法进行研究,提出改进的中位值平均滤波算法和改进的EWMA算法。改进的中位值平均滤波算法在滤波输出节点位置计算中引入自适应滤波因子和偏移预测量,改进的EWMA算法在角度平滑计算中引入自适应权重动态分配函数。在算法的数据仿真测试中,分别用改进后的两个算法和各自的原算法进行测试和比较分析,实验结果表明,改进算法保证了节点基本静止时滤波和平滑的稳定性,兼顾用户动作变化时节点滤波预测位置的实时性和角度平滑值输出的实时性,优于同类其它算法。

全文